Decoding Campaign Optimization Pricing Models: Finding the Sweet Spot
In the dynamic world of digital advertising, initiative optimization is paramount to achieving desired results. Pricing models influence a pivotal role in this process, dictating how you allocate your budget and ultimately impacting your return on investment (ROI). One common model is cost-per-click (CPC), where you pay each time a user taps with your ad. This model offers clarity in terms of costs, but it's important to track click quality to ensure that clicks translate into valuable leads. Another popular option is cost-per-impression (CPM), which bills you for every thousand times your ad is displayed. CPM can be effective for building brand awareness, but it may not directly correlate with conversions unless strategically coupled with other optimization techniques.
Furthermore, consider models like cost-per-acquisition (CPA), which prioritizes paying only when a user completes a desired task. This model can be particularly profitable for businesses with explicit conversion goals.
- Ultimately, the best pricing model for your campaign depends on your objectives, budget constraints, and industry benchmarks.
- Continuously analyzing performance metrics and adjusting your strategy based on insights gained is key to maximizing ROI.
